Understanding TCF Language Test Price: A Comprehensive Guide
The Test de Connaissance du Français (TCF) is a standardized test designed to evaluate the French language efficiency of non-native speakers. It is widely acknowledged by universities, companies, and government bodies in French-speaking countries. As prospective test-takers often question about the costs associated with the TCF, this article intends to provide a thorough understanding of the TCF language test price, consisting of aspects affecting the expense, a breakdown of costs, and a detailed FAQ area.

TCF Language Test Pricing Breakdown
Here is a detailed summary of the typical TCF price breakdown:
Test TypeApproximate Cost (Local Currency)Additional FeesTCF Tout PublicEUR120 - EUR200Preparation materials (EUR30+)TCF put la DémolitionEUR150 - EUR210No extra feesTCF put le QuébecEUR150 - EUR220Preparation courses (EUR100+)TCF-- Listening/Reading OnlyEUR80 - EUR120No extra chargesTCF-- Speaking/Writing OnlyEUR80 - EUR120No extra costs
Keep in mind: Prices may vary based upon the screening center and area. It is recommended to talk to the particular center for the most accurate rates.
